When creativity meets strategy that is the best advertisement a product can get. When you do a brainstorming session you will get different ideas about how to make the radio ad successful. The motive of the ad should be attracting the people towards the product and make them buy. But can you simply give an ad and expect the people to buy it? The answer is no, you will have to put some thoughts and hard work into the making of the ad to get a good response.

The message of the ad should reach the people without much effort. When you plan to give an ad about some product whose variations are already there in the market, make sure that your product does not come under their group. Avoid it by adding some creativity which can make the crowd remember about the product.

There are places where emotions can attract the people rather than logic. If you are able to find out a way to create a radio ad which has emotions such as mother-baby, family togetherness etc, there is no doubt that the audience will also be able to connect that emotion which you are showcasing. Have ever thought that reading a sentence with a comma can entirely change the meaning of it?

Like the same way when you read a sentence, use different tones which can make the people understand about it. It does not mean that you need to add words which are so hard for the people to digest. Simple ways are always welcomed by the audience rather than difficult ways. The success of the radio ad is in the opening sentence. If the starting of the ad is liked by the audience, then it is sure that they are going to hear the entire ad.

If you start the ad with a low energy, you should expect low response too. Your ad should be in such a way that people should feel that, yes, this is what was exactly looking for. Remember that the 60 seconds you get for your ad, decides about your advertising future.

An ad gets a completion when it the written things are put into action and then formation. An ad creator first, pens down the first thing that comes to their mind when they think about a product which they need to do an advertisement. You cannot simply write down anything and then take it to another level. Of course, like said before the first thing that comes to mind is important, however, how an ad person takes it to a next level is the question.

There are some major points one need to think about before writing a script for an ad. The first and the foremost thing is the timing of the ad. Some ads may be for 30 seconds while some get a good one minute for showing their ad. When you get the idea of the time allocated to the ad, you can start writing the script according to it.

The first few seconds of the ad is important as those are the seconds which make the audience glued to their chair. In that few seconds, you should give an idea about what item are you advertising for. In a radio ad, people cannot see you; it is your voice that connects you with the audience. Try to come up with some style which can attract the audience. Writing for a 60-second ad is not that easy. You will have to write the ad in such a way that you should be able to tell the entire story in those 60 seconds.

Your product knowledge will be tested when you write an ad. So it is important to do a research on the item you are going to write an ad. Every ad has got some target customers. For example, if you are writing an ad for an energy drink, the script should target the age group of 20-40 years. With these simple steps, you can create a good ad script.

When you hear tips, do not think that this is an easy step. Tips can only help you to get an idea about the 30 sec ad. Before creating any ad the basic thing one should need is the understanding of the product they are going to make an ad on. Without a basic understanding of the product, you will not able to create an ad that can reach to the audience, instead, it will adversely affect the product.

Try to connect with the audience with your voice, tone and showing empathy. Remember that in a radio ad, people connect to you through what you say, not through vision. For a 30 second ad, the major thing you need to understand is you need to tell the story in at least 28 seconds. So create a script that can show the value of the product in simple words which should be transparent to the audience.

Try to make the script direct rather than making it confusing for the audience. Your tone plays an important role in the success of the ad. If people feel like you are simply reading out from a piece of paper, it will not create any hype for the product. Use your tones in such a way that in that 30 second you can take the audience to another world.

For a radio ad, natural stories are the best scripts rather than fiction and fantasy stories. For these stories, vision is more important. Remember, you are presenting a product in your words in front of the audience. They should get attracted to what you are saying and should wait for what you are going to say. If you are successful in creating a 30 seconds ad and if the products reach the audience, then you can consider yourself as a successful ad writer.
